TUI hint at ASTI merger

The Teachers Union of Ireland General Secretary John MacGabhann has said it is time to seriously consider merging with the Association of Secondary Teachers in Ireland.

In his address to 400 delegates in Kilkenny this afternoon MacGabhann noted it is “illogical, often absurd and certainly wasteful” to have two unions at second level.

He added the TUI and ASTI face common challenges and threats, which they could see off more effectively if they act as one.
